ios - UIWebView获取图标

标签 ios uiwebview

我如何从ios UIWebView中的网站获取网站图标,就像在android中一样。
也许我的问题是白痴,但我找不到任何东西。

最佳答案

您可以使用其网址字符串获取任何网站的网站图标。下面以我们尝试获取google网站图标为例:

NSString *myURLString = @"http://www.google.com/s2/favicons?domain=www.stackoverflow.com";
NSURL *myURL=[NSURL URLWithString: myURLString];
NSData *myData=[NSData dataWithContentsOfURL:myURL];

UIImage *myImage=[[UIImage alloc] initWithData:myData];

这种获取收藏图标的方法对我来说效果很好。

祝一切顺利。

关于ios - UIWebView获取图标,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19424654/

相关文章:

javascript - HTML/JavaScript : Fix scroll position after screen rotation

objective-c - 将包含图像、javascript 和 css 的 html 页面保存在 iphone 应用程序的一个文件夹中

ios - 在 Swift 中将闭包分配给变量会导致 'variable used before being initialized'

ios - 如何在默认 UITableViewCell 的标签中添加链接

ios - fatal error : Index out of range for in loops swift 3

ios - 为什么 UIWebViewDelegate 分配而不是弱?

ios - 从 webview 中提取文本

android - 世博会:世博会构建和世博会上传有什么区别

ios - 获取之前应用版本的应用商店信息

iphone - uiwebview中如何实现触摸事件?